French drain installation services involve creating a drainage system designed to redirect excess water away from specific areas of a property. Typically, this process includes digging a trench, placing a perforated pipe within the trench, and covering it with gravel or other permeable materials. The purpose of the system is to facilitate the movement of water underground, preventing it from pooling or accumulating in unwanted locations. Proper installation ensures that water is effectively channeled away from foundations, basements, or landscaping features, helping to manage excess moisture and protect the property's structural integrity.

This service addresses common problems associated with poor drainage, such as basement flooding, soggy lawns, and soil erosion. Excess water can cause significant damage to a property's foundation, leading to costly repairs and compromised safety. French drains are also effective in reducing standing water around walkways, patios, and driveways, which can become hazardous or cause damage over time. By installing a properly designed drainage system, property owners can mitigate the risks associated with water accumulation and maintain a more stable and healthy landscape.

Material and Excavation Costs - The cost for materials and excavation typ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,000 depending on the size of the area and soil conditions. For example, a standard residential installation might fall within this range.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ific site requirements.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ing a French drain generally vary between $50 and $100 per hour. Total labor charges depend on project complexity and duration, often totaling $1,500 to $4,000 for an average installation.

Additional Materials and Permits - Expenses for additional materials, such as gravel or piping, can add $200 to $800 to the overall cost. Permit fees may also apply, typically ranging from $50 to $200, depending on local regulations.

Total Project Estimates - Overall costs for French drain installation usually range from $2,000 to $7,000. Variations depend on property size, drainage needs, and site conditions, with local service providers offering detailed quotes.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a French drain? A French drain is a trench filled with gravel or rock that redirects surface or groundwater away from an area, helping to prevent water accumulation and damage.

How long does a French drain installation typically take? The duration of installation varies based on the property's size and complexity, but local service providers can provide estimates during consultations.

What are common reasons to install a French drain? French drains are often installed to address basement flooding, soggy yards, or excess surface water around a property.

Can a French drain be installed in any landscape? Most landscapes can accommodate a French drain, though specific site conditions may influence installation options; consulting local pros is recommended.

What maintenance is required for a French drain? Generally, French drains require minimal maintenance, but periodic inspection and clearing of debris can help ensure proper function.
